Upload a file to AWS S3

Upload a file to AWS S3, similar to aws s3 cp file.txt s3://bucket/path/file.txt, but if the destination file (S3 object) already exists, do not overwrite it (do not upload new version).

We use this script in our CI pipelines.

Installation

$ pip install 'upload-to-s3 @ https://github.com/leadhub-code/upload-to-s3/archive/v0.0.3.zip'

Usage

You need to have AWS credentials prepared:

  • create file .aws/credentials (for example using aws configure), or
  • set env variables AWS_ACCESS_KEY_ID and AWS_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Y
    • for example on CircleCI see "Project settings" -> "Environment Variables"
  • or use any other way documented in boto3 Credentials
$ upload_to_s3 --public --content-type text/plain foo.txt s3://bucket/path/foo.txt

AWS IAM permissions

Terraform example:

resource "aws_iam_user" "example_user" {
  name = "example_user"
}

resource "aws_iam_user_policy" "example_user" {
  user = aws_iam_user.example_user.name
  policy = jsonencode({
    Version = "2012-10-17"
    Statement = [
      {
        Action = ["s3:GetObject*", "s3:PutObject*"]
        Resource = ["arn:aws:s3:::example-bucket/example-path/*"]
        Effect = "Allow"
      }, {
        Action = ["s3:GetBucketLocation", "s3:ListBucket"]
        Resource = ["arn:aws:s3:::example-bucket"]
        Effect = "Allow"
      },
    ]
  })
}
